    Lamb and Beef Barley Stew




    Lamb was from a previous cook on the pit and the beef were end cuts from my Top Round "French Dippers" cook.


    Mix night before
    • 2 tablespoon McCormick Beef base
    • 4 bay leaves
    • 6 garlic clove
    • 1 teaspoon black pepper
    • 1 tablespoon garlic and
    • 1 Tablespoon Onion Powder1 teaspoon parsley
    • 1 teaspoon basil


    Day Of.
    • Beef (end cuts from top round cooked on the pit)
    • Lamb, pre cooked and thawed
    • 4 Tablespoons butter
    • One chopped onion
    • 4 celery stalks
    • 3 carrots
    • 1/4 cup vermouth
    • Two quarts beef broth
    •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ire
    • 1 cups cooked barley
    • Corn Starch to thicken


    1. Place Butter in DO
    2. Add chopped onion, saute
    3. Add beef, brown beef.
    4. Add celery (toss in a tablespoon of flour optional)
    5. add lamb
    6. add beef broth, vermouth, spices and carrots.
    7. cook barley in a separate pot of water at least 30 minutes then add to stew
    8. Cook for a few hours, slowly adding Corn Starch to thicken
    9. Serve in a bowl, or my favorite way... on top of some buttered mash potatoes.
